Kabayan Ko, Kapatid Ko | Lingap sa Mamamayan

Kabayan Ko, Kapatid Ko (My Countrymen, My Brethren) project was launched by Brother Eduardo V. Manalo, the Executive Minister of the Church of Christ (Iglesia Ni Cristo). He likewise urged the brethren to further propagate the faith and share the message of salvation to all humanity, especially to our countrymen.

The project is held regularly in different parts of the Philippines and the World!
Last May 24, 2014, the Church of Christ (Iglesia ni Cristo) conducted its My Countrymen, My Brethren; Aid to Humanity (Kabayan Ko Kapatid Ko; Lingap sa Mamamayan) Program in Panaad Park and Stadium, Bacolod City, Negros Occidental. Through the Felix Y. Manalo Foundation, thousands of indigent Negrosanons (members and non-members of the Church) were given aid such as food and other basic needs in compliance with the biblical mandate “Love your neighbor as yourself” (Matthew 22:38 NIV).

Not only that the Iglesia Ni Cristo provide humanitarian aid but also holds its “Evangelical Mission” campaign. For the information of everybody, Iglesia Ni Cristo’s Evangelical Mission is an activity in which the Word of God is being shared with non-members who join the event. Knowing that the aid, such as food, given by the church is only but temporary, the Church acknowledges the greater need for the recipients to obtain the spiritual food which is the word of God.
